Output 31b8b4059017bacf6fead9cd9d15dc845cf966307f645b1590eac0ca7359eb13:54

value
141829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cf8e70250999f8a4ee3ce48f0fa65d1ada7cc1 OP_EQUAL
address
34mns9PvHaDpdCrsCe5AoX1vTiYbGtpq9h
transaction
31b8b4059017bacf6fead9cd9d15dc845cf966307f645b1590eac0ca7359eb13
confirmations
261181
spent
true